🇬🇧 Sewage meaning: English Vocabulary Flash Card

noun
Sewage is the dirty water and human waste that go down toilets, sinks, and drains in houses and buildings. Instead of just staying there, this yucky water travels through big underground pipes to special cleaning places, called treatment plants. There, machines and helpful germs clean the sewage so it doesn’t make people sick or pollute rivers and oceans. Sewage is gross, but the sewage system is important because it keeps our towns clean and healthy.
